Latest Patents
Miahs patent, titled "Sliding Compression Retainers for Staple Cartridges with Implantable Adjuncts," represents a notable advancement in surgical systems. This invention provides retainers and retainer systems that facilitate the application of a compressive force to implantable adjuncts on staple cartridges. This innovation not only enhances the efficiency of staple cartridges but also contributes to the overall efficacy of surgical procedures involving implantable adjuncts.
